Web the 4 cs of diamonds — cut, color, clarity and carat — are the four characteristics that determine a diamond’s quality and value. Clarity considers a diamond’s inclusions and blemishes and how they affect its appearance. These four criteria interact with one another to create the brilliant sparkle of diamonds. Additionally, diamond anatomy plays a large role in the 4cs, as differences in diamond proportions and measurements can affect their grade.
